Improving the Performance of Plastics

In the automotive industry and other sectors, glass beads are used as reinforcement materials for plastics. The focus is on optimising compressive strength, increasing abrasion and scratch resistance, reducing warpage and shrinkage and improving surface appearance.

In so-called hybrid combinations of glass fibre and glass bead reinforcement, plastic compounds combine the high stiffness of glass fibre with the warpage-reducing effect of glass beads. This enables targeted enhancement of mechanical properties – resulting in durable, stable components.
